Development of Methods for Detection of Lipid Peroxidation Products in Human Tissues Generated by Environmental Toxins.

reportActive / Technical Report | Accession Number: ADA254091 | Open PDF

Abstract:

Research to date has resulted in the synthesis of isotope labelled 9- oxononanoate and the development of generic methods for the introduction of a variety of isotopic labels in the 4-hydroxyalkenals. Additional studies demonstrated that 4-hydroxyalkenals could be released from protein sulfhydryl groups. Future studies will investigate whether 4-hyroxynonenal binds to the sulfhydral groups on human rhodopsin interfering with the visual transduction process.
